How to Make This Recipe
- Preheat your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
- In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
- Cut the butter into small pieces and add it to the dry ingredients. Use your fingers to work the butter into the flour mixture until it resembles coarse crumbs.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, egg, and vanilla extract.
-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ix until just combined. Do not overmix.
- Pour the batter into a 9-inch pie plate that has been greased and floured.
- Arrange the apple slices on top of the batter.
- Sprinkle the pie with sugar and cinnamon.
- Bake the pie for 45-50 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the filling is bubbling.

Tips
- For a crispier crust, bake the pie for an additional 5-10 minutes.
- If you don’t have any fresh apples on hand, you can use frozen apples instead. Just be sure to thaw them completely before using them in the recipe.
- You can also add other fruits to the pie, such as pears, peaches, or berries.

To make the pastry, combine the flour, sugar, and salt in a large bowl. Cut in the but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Add the ice water and mix until the dough just comes together. Form the dough into a ball, wrap it in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
Granny Smith apples are a good choice for apple pie because they are tart and crisp, which helps to balance out the sweetness of the pie filling. Other good choices include Honeycrisp apples, Fuji apples, and Pink Lady apples.
To prevent the apples from browning, toss them with a little lemon juice before adding them to the pie.
